What may work is if you take a taxi in the morning and ask for your driver's number to call when you need to return back, it might work, but of course also depends on how many other ships are in port that day. You could also take the public bus which lets off across the highway but it is a bit of a walk downhill to the dock, so depends on your mobility.     Ward Cove

    Another thing to consider is how many other ships will be in town that day. There's a lot of information over at Trip Advisor about how there is no infrastructure, steep hike, busy highway to cross, unmarked bus stop etc etc. It's generally advised to not walk to get the Silver Line bus. We are coming in on a day when there is only one other ship docked downtown about 4 hours after we dock, so we should be able to get a taxi quite easily to go to Totem Bight.
